According to Investopedia.com, “Tick size refers to the minimum price movement of a trading instrument in a market. The price movements of different trading instruments vary, with their tick sizes representing the minimum amount they can move up or down on an exchange.”
If you have a five-year tick data of a trading instrument like EURUSD in Forex, it means that you have all the price movements of that trading instrument during these five years.
In addition to tick data, there are other types of data including 1-Minute (M1), 1-Hour (H1), and Daily (D1). These data do not have the quality of tick data. In tick data, all the price movements are completely available, but in M1, H1, and Daily data, only OHLC or Open, High, Low, and Close prices of a bar are available; and what happens inside the bar is unknown.
MetaTrader 4 cannot understand tick data in backtest. So, to have the most accurate backtest with MT4 (99% precision), we need to import tick data into MetaTrader. This can be done with third-party software or script.
